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99 44 0441974 665197
16 934369191 0781469
16 934369191 0781469
11 4319581254 753
All about undefined
Interested in learning more?
16 934369191 0781469
11 4319581254 753
See more
6064922356 4971 15674926309
10 254 29557039 632 7241109840
See more
203407213 400759288
59 25 45065309157 50825346938 20
See more